19 Danish Proverbs about Even
All Danish Proverbs | Proverbs about Even1. A joyous evening often leads to a sorrowful morning.
2. Art is art, even though unsuccessful.
3. Better one cow in peace than seven in trouble.
4. Even a small star shines in the darkness.
5. Even clever hens sometimes lay their eggs among nettles.
6. Even crumbs are bread.
7. Even doubtful accusations leave a stain behind them.
8. Even he gets on who is drawn by oxen.
9. Even that fish may be caught that strives the hardest against it.
10. Every day has its evening.
11. He who would seek revenge must be on his own guard.
12. In taking revenge, a man is but even with his enemy; but in passing it over, he is superior.
13. Peace must be bought even at a high price.
14. People must eat, even were every tree a gallows.
15. Praise a fair day in the evening.
16. We must sow even after a bad harvest.
17. A beautiful face is admired even when its owner doesn't say anything.
18. A boor remains a boor even if sleeping on silken pillows.
19. Ambition and revenge are always hungry.
